The Champions League is coming soon and many are already anticipating this important annual event in football. Supposedly, the Champions League was to be held at the Krestovsky Stadium in Saint Petersburg, Russia. However, on Feb 25, the UEFA has decided to strip Saint Petersburg, Russia the right to host the match following the recent events.

Instead of Russia, the Champions League final will be held at the Stade de France in Saint-Denis, Paris. This will be the third time that the final will be staged here and the first time since 2006. With that, the official schedule of the Champions League final is May 28, 2022, Saturday, at the Stade de France, Saint-Denis, France.
